I had a peristomal hernia/prolapse repaired recently. Ostomy nurse crusted me, and I immediately developed a leak behind my wafer. So, summary judgment: crusting bad, nurse bad. I have bleeding around my stoma from the badly irritated skin, so nothing sticks. The wafer doesn't stick. Hydrocolloid rings don't stick. Oh wait, my poo sticks superbly and has massively irritated my skin. Is there any solution that will stick to my skin as well or better than my own poo? Thank you for your suggestions.

Hi B,

Sounds like you'll need to get some aluminum acetate powder (Domeboro or generic) at any pharmacy or online and use it as described. It'll calm down your skin so stuff will stick. You'll need to do it pretty frequently at first to get the skin to heal, and then use it sparingly until your skin is back to normal.
